Hi, yep I got pwned. Sorry everyone, very embarrassing. More info: - https://github.com/chalk/chalk/issues/656 - https://github.com/debug-js/debug/issues/1005#issuecomment-3... Affected packages (at least the ones I know of): - ansi-styles@6.2.2 - debug@4.4.2 (appears to have been yanked as of 8 Sep 18:09 CEST) - chalk@5.6.1 - supports-color@10.2.1 - strip-ansi@7.1.1 - ansi-regex@6.2.1 - wrap-ansi@9.0.1 - color-conve…
I actually got hit by something that sounds very similar back in July. I was saved by my DNS settings where "npNjs dot com" wound up on a blocklist. I might be paranoid, but it felt targeted and was of a higher level of believability than I'd seen before.
I also more recently received another email asking for an academic interview about "understanding why popular packages wouldn't have been published in a while" that felt like elicitation or an attempt to get publishing access.
Sadly both of the original emails are now deleted so I don't have the exact details anymore, but stay safe out there everyone.
